Wokingham In Need and the King's Award for Voluntary Service
Primary sponsor
Clive Jones
Motion Text
That this House congratulates Wokingham-based charity Wokingham In Need, and its founder Sue Jackson, on receiving the King's Award for Voluntary Service; recognises the vital work done by Wokingham In Need and similar organisations in communities across the UK in providing for homeless and vulnerable people; recognises that poverty exists in every community in the UK and is devastating for those who experience it; and calls on the Government to do more to ensure that all communities in the UK are resourced to support the vulnerable regardless of crude statistical measures of deprivation.
